EED and IBM Team to Deliver Comprehensive eDiscovery Software and Services
Companies address the eDiscovery needs of both legal and IT department
NEW YORK CITY (Legal Tech Conference) – February 6, 2008 –Electronic Evidence Discovery, Inc. (EED), the pioneering leader in eDiscovery, today announced that they are teaming with IBM to address the growing eDiscovery needs of global organizations. Recognizing that eDiscovery requirements span corporate IT and legal departments, EED and IBM will work together to offer customers comprehensive professional services and complementary software solutions to address these needs.
As part of the agreement, EED will serve as a legal eDiscovery business partner to IBM, offering legal eDiscovery Process Design consulting and corporate Litigation Readiness services to IBM customers, as well as reactive eDiscovery services for individual outsourced litigation.
“EED’s legal discovery consulting services are an excellent complement to IBM ECM professional services and IBM Global Business Services,” said Dave McCann, chief executive officer of EED, Inc. “We expect to support IBM in a variety of opportunities involving corporate legal departments looking for eDiscovery solutions, and we also expect to assist in the development, design and review of complementary eDiscovery-based collateral and products. We are fortunate to have a partner such as IBM that is helping us champion the message of proactive eDiscovery preparedness, intelligent archiving, automated classification and records management.”
EED is also building a Content Enabled Vertical Application (CEVA) on top of the IBM FileNet P8 platform for Fortune 500 companies and their legal departments. The application will include technology from EED and IBM such as IBM Records Crawler.
